A new alternative to produce gibberellic acid by solid state fermentation BABT
Rodrigues,Cristine; Vandenberghe,Luciana Porto de Souza; Teodoro,Juliana; Oss,Juliana Fraron; Pandey,Ashok; Soccol,Carlos Ricardo.
Gibberellic acid (GA3) is an important hormone, which controls plant's growth and development. Solid State Fermentation (SSF) allows the use of agro-industrial residues reducing the production costs. The screening of strains (four of Gibberella fujikuoroi and one of Fusarium moniliforme) and substrates (citric pulp, soy bran, sugarcane bagasse, soy husk, cassava bagasse and coffee husk) and inoculum preparation study were conducted in order to evaluate the best conditions to produce GA3 by SSF. Fermentation assays were carried out in erlenmeyers flasks at 29°C, with initial moisture of 75-80%. Bioprocessing of some agro-industrial residues for endoglucanase production by the new subsp.; Streptomyces albogriseolus subsp. cellulolyticus strain NEAE-J BJM
El-Naggar,Noura El-Ahmady; Abdelwahed,Nayera A.M.; Saber,Wesam I.A.; Mohamed,Asem A..
The use of low cost agro-industrial residues for the production of industrial enzymes is one of the ways to reduce significantly production costs. Cellulase producing actinomycetes were isolated from soil and decayed agricultural wastes. Among them, a potential culture, strain NEAE-J, was selected and identified on the basis of morphological, cultural, physiological and chemotaxonomic properties, together with 16S rDNA sequence. It is proposed that strain NEAE-J should be included in the species Streptomyces albogriseolus as a representative of a novel sub-species, Streptomyces albogriseolus subsp. cellulolyticus strain NEAE-J and sequencing product was deposited in the GenBank database under accession number JN229412. Column bioreactor use for optimization of pectinase production in solid substrate cultivation BJM
Linde,Giani Andrea; Magagnin,Glênio; Costa,Jorge Alberto Vieira; Bertolin,Telma Elita; Colauto,Nelson Barros.
This study aimed to determine the influence of process variables and production, of polygalacturonase (PG) and polymetylgalacturonase (PMG) by solid substrate cultivation using a fixed bed column bioreactor. A fractional factorial design (FFD) was used to study the effect of the following variables: microorganism (Aspergillus oryzae and Aspergillus niger), substratum (wheat bran and defatted rice bran), aeration (40 and 60 ml h-1g-1), pectin (5 and 10 g g-1) and nitrogen (urea and ammonium sulfate). Microorganism, aeration and initial pectin were identified in FFD as significant variables (p<0.05) on PG production. Rice bran as a substrate for proteolytic enzyme production BABT
Sumantha,Alagarsamy; Deepa,Paul; Sandhya,Chandran; Szakacs,George; Soccol,Carlos Ricardo; Pandey,Ashok.
Rice bran was used as the substrate for screening nine strains of Rhizopus sp. for neutral protease production by solid-state fermentation. The best producer, Rhizopus microsporus NRRL 3671, was used for optimizing the process parameters for enzyme production. Fermentation carried out with 44.44 % initial moisture content at a temperature of 30 C for 72 h was found to be the optimum for enzyme secretion by the fermenting organism. While most of the carbon supplements favored enzyme production, addition of casein resulted in a marginal increase in protease yield. Spore production of Beauveria bassiana from agro-industrial residues BABT
Santa,Herta Stutz Dalla; Santa,Osmar Roberto Dalla; Brand,Débora; Vandenberghe,Luciana Porto de Souza; Soccol,Carlos Ricardo.
The purpose of this work was to produce Beauveria bassiana by Solid-State Fermentation using agro-industrial residues and optimizing the cultivation conditions. Refused potatoes, coffee husks and sugar-cane bagasse were tested. The blend of refused potatoes and sugar-cane bagasse (60-40%) with particle size in the range of 0.8-2 mm was used in the fermentation experiments. In Erlenmeyer flasks the best spore production was achieved with the following conditions: incubation temperature 26º C; initial pH 6.0; inoculum concentration 10(7) spores.g-1.dw and initial moisture 75%. Use of sawdust Eucalyptus sp. in the preparation of activated carbons Ciência e Agrotecnologia
Couto,Gabriela Martucci; Dessimoni,Anelise Lima de Abreu; Bianchi,Maria Lúcia; Perígolo,Deise Morone; Trugilho,Paulo Fernando.
Wood sawdust is a solid residue, generated in the timber industry, which is of no profitable use and can cause serious environmental problems if disposed inadequately. The aim of this study was to use the eucalyptus sawdust in the preparation of activated carbons AC) and test them as adsorbents of methylene blue (MB) and phenol, representative pollutants from aqueous effluents of various industries. The eucalyptus sawdust was characterized by instrumental analysis such as elementary analysis (CHNS-O), thermogravimetric analysis (TGA), infrared spectroscopy (FTIR) and scanning electron microscopy (SEM).
